Recap - Spartans Defeat Hawaii 35-0

Kairee Robinson ran for 146 yards as San Jose State handled Hawaii by a score of 35-0 on Sunday at Clarence T.C. Ching Complex.

San Jose State won and also put money in the pockets of their supporters by covering the -10.5-point spread as favorites. Totals bettors, meanwhile, saw the game go UNDER the closing number of 57.5.

Kairee Robinson rushed for 146 yards, while Quali Conley added 73 yards in the win. Nick Nash and Charles Ross added 86 and 55 receiving yards respectively.

Matthew Shipley rushed for 17 yards for Hawaii, while Landon Sims added 15 yards. Brayden Schager threw for 132 yards for the Rainbow Warriors, while receivers Alex Perry and Steven McBride had 42 and 32 yards respectively.

Hawaii lost the offensive yardage battle to San Jose State 468-198 yards in Sunday's game. San Jose State had more first downs as that total ended up 22-14.

Hawaii lost the time of possession battle 35:11-24:49, leaving their defense on the field more than they wanted.

San Jose State looks to continue their winning ways next game with a battle against Fresno State. Hawaii will aim to get back on the winning track at Nevada.
